#0e370d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e370d is composed of 5.5% red, 21.6%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 118.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 13.3%. #0e370d color hex could be obtained by blending #1c6e1a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#0e370d color description : Very dark lime green.
#0e370d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e370d has RGB values of R:14, G:55,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 931597.
